Volodymyr Kapustianskyi has been competing for 4 years. His best event is the Clock: a personal-best single of 1.64, set at Moorhead Madness 2025, puts him in the top 0.012% of the 32,048 people who have ever been ranked in the event, and 2nd in the United States. Until May 2025, no official Clock solve in the world had been that fast. Across 30 competitions since August 2022, he has put 1,098 official solves on the record across twelve events. Solve to solve, his 3×3 times vary about 14% around a typical one; 64% of the 35,811 competitors with ten or more counted rounds hold a tighter spread. His Clock best has come down from 7.99 in May 2023 to 1.64, a 79% improvement. Volodymyr has entered 30 competitions, more competitions than 98% of everyone who has ever competed.

Reading this page: a single is one solve's time · an average is the middle three of five solves, best and worst discarded · a PB is a personal best · a DNF (did not finish) is an attempt with no valid result: a popped piece, an unsolved face, an over-limit memorisation · top X% compares against everyone ever ranked in that event, which is fairer than raw rank because event pools differ tenfold.
